TITLE
Automatical composition of poems and songs

ABSTRACT
Constraints are a major factor shaping the conceptual space of many areas of creativity. We propose to use constraint programming techniques and off-the-shelf constraint solvers in the creative task of poetry writing.

We also address the challenging task of automatically composing lyrical songs with matching musical and lyrical
features, and we present the first prototype, M.U. Sicus-Apparatus, to accomplish the task.
